Lebanon at the 1980 Summer Olympics
Sporting event delegation From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Lebanon competed at the 1980 Summer Olympics in Moscow, USSR. They entered 15 competitors, all men, who took part in 16 events in 8 sports.[1]

Medalists
Bronze
- Hassan Bchara — Wrestling, Men's Greco-Roman Super Heavyweight
